41 North to the last Oshkosh exit (Jackson St). Big landfill will be on your right. At the bottom of the off ramp turn right. Go approx. 1 mile to the first traffic light and turn left. Approx. 1/2 mile down that road will be the entrance to the park on the right.
Once you see the landfill (just past the prison) you're basically there. The park is just on the other side of the landfill (no, it doesn't stink). :D
